Admission Details
-
All applicants are required to appear in Joint Entrance Exam (JEE) Main Paper 1 Conducted by National Testing Agency (NTA). The University shall not conduct its own CET for admissions, but shall be utilizing the merit of JEE Main Paper 1 for its admissions. The admissions would be based on the merit / rank in the JEE.
Lateral Entry to B.Tech. Programmes for Diploma holder: Applicants must appear in the CET conducted. The admissions would be based on the merit / rank in the CET.
Lateral Entry to B.Tech. Programmes for B.Sc. Graduates: Applicants must appear in the CET conducted. The admissions would be based on the merit / rank in the CET.
Eligibility Criteria
Passed 10+2 examination with Physics and Mathematics as compulsory subjects along with one of the Chemistry/ Biotechnology/ Biology/ Technical Vocational subject/ Computer Science/ Information Technology/ Informatics Practices/ Agriculture/ Engineering Graphics/ Business Studies. Obtained at least 45% marks (40% marks in case of candidates belonging to reserved category) in the above subjects taken together. OR Passed Diploma (in Engineering and Technology) examination with at least 45% marks (40% marks in case of candidates belonging to reserved category) subject to vacancies in the First Year, in case the vacancies at lateral entry are exhausted.
Pass in 12th Class of 10+2 pattern of CBSE or equivalent with a minimum aggregate of 55% marks in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ics provided the candidate has passed in each subject separately. Candidate must additionally have passed English as a subject of study (core/ elective/ functional) in the qualifying examination.
Lateral Entry to B.Tech. Programmes for Diploma holder: Three-years diploma (completed) in any of the following branches of Engg./Technology with a minimum of 60% marks in aggregate from any recognized Diploma awarding institute/university/board recognized by AICTE:- Computer Engg; Automobile Engg; Chemical Engg, Civil Engg, Construction Engg, Electrical Engg, Electronics & Communication Engg, Electronics, Instrumentation & Control, Mechanical Engg., Maintenance Engg., Plastic Engg., Printing & Publishing, Production Engg., Public Health & Environmental Engg., Tool & Die Making.
Lateral Entry to B.Tech. Programmes for B.Sc. Graduates: B.Sc. Graduates with 60% marks in aggregate* with pass in Mathematics as a subject from any recognized University.
